How to Resolve GIFs Not Showing in Microsoft Teams

1. Disable Hardware Acceleration

One of the primary reasons for GIFs not showing in Teams could be due to hardware acceleration. This feature uses your computer's GPU to speed up graphics-intensive tasks. However, sometimes it can cause conflicts and lead to issues with displaying GIFs. To disable hardware acceleration, go to the Teams settings by clicking on your profile picture and selecting 'Settings.' Then, go to the 'General' tab and uncheck the 'Enable GPU hardware acceleration' option. This will optimize Teams' performance and may resolve the issue with GIFs not showing.

2. Configure Microsoft Teams Settings Correctly



About How to Resolve GIFs Not Showing in Microsoft Teams, If disabling hardware acceleration doesn't work, you may need to check your Teams settings to ensure GIFs are enabled. To do this, click on your profile picture and select 'Settings' again. Then, in the 'General' tab, make sure the 'Optional Connected Experiences' setting is turned on. Next, expand the 'Fun Stuff' section and make sure the 'GIFs, stickers, and memes' option is also turned on. If it was turned off, turning it back on should resolve the issue.

3. Clear Microsoft Teams Cache


Sometimes, the issue with GIFs not showing in Teams can be due to corrupted or outdated cache files. To fix this, you can try clearing Teams' cache by deleting specific folders. These folders may vary depending on your operating system, but the most common ones are Cache, blob_storage, Code Cache, GPUCache, Local Storage, IndexedDB, databases, and tmp. You can find these folders by typing '%appdata%\Microsoft\Teams' in the Windows search bar. Once you've located these folders, delete them, and restart Microsoft Teams. This will force Teams to rebuild its cache, and hopefully, your GIFs will start showing again.

4. Reinstall Microsoft Teams


If none of the above steps work, you may need to reinstall Microsoft Teams. It's possible that the installation files have become corrupted, leading to issues with displaying GIFs. To reinstall Teams, go to the Microsoft Store and search for Teams. Click on the 'Get' button to download and install Teams again. After the installation is complete, check if the issue with GIFs not showing has been resolved.


If the above steps don't work, it's possible that your organization's admin has disabled GIFs for your group. In this case, you may need to consult with your administrator to check if there are any policy settings blocking GIFs. If there are, your administrator can make the necessary changes to allow GIFs for your group.
